2 trucks checked at Woodlands Checkpoint found to have 1.5 tonnes of illegally imported M'sian produce

Two trucks at Woodlands Checkpoint were found to have about 1.5 tonnes of illegally imported Malaysian fresh produce and processed food, which were seized by the Singapore Food Agency (SFA). Read more at stomp.straitstimes.com

Singapore is making it easier for tourists to enter the country

Singapore is introducing a QR code system for drivers crossing the border, replacing traditional passports. The system, starting from March 19, allows travelers to generate a single QR code for all passengers in their vehicle, reducing wait times by 30%. The initiative aligns with Singapore s commitment to embracing technology and improving efficiency in border crossings.
